Additional methods on EventLoop
that are specific to Windows.

Creates an event loop off of the main thread.
Window
caveats
Note that any Window
created on the new thread will be destroyed when the thread
terminates. Attempting to use a Window
after its parent thread terminates has
unspecified, although explicitly not undefined, behavior.

By default, tao on Windows will attempt to enable process-wide DPI awareness. If that’s
undesirable, you can create an EventLoop
using this function instead.

Creates a DPI-unaware event loop off of the main thread.
The Window
caveats in new_any_thread
also apply here.
